Update - 12/2/04
Alright guys, I've installed my version of illuminated door sills on the driver's side and will do the passenger side this weekend (Wish I could get it done before Sat to show it off at the NOVA meet but its not gonna happen). I will post pics this weekend so stay tuned. Oh and just to give you a heads up on the install, it was very easy and didn't take too long. Just have to make sure you have the right materials and tools. It's definitely a DIY project. Pics to come soon!

Originally Posted by evilone
can you do that with the type s sills?
I'm also in the process of hooking up with a CNC machinist who might be able to do some sets of aluminum sills for me. I currently have an ACURA font which I might be able to use (have to ask permission of author) with the CNC machine. Assuming "ACURA" could be done, I would think "Type S" would be possible as well.
